MPC Data Training Workshops

The Minnesota Population Center offers several training opportunities for MPC members, staff, graduate students, postdoctoral associates, and the public.

MPC Data Training Workshops

In these hands-on workshops, local researchers will learn about the content of MPC's free data resources and receive basic information about how to get and use the data.

  • MPC Data Training Workshops at Wilson Library.  Learn to access free social science and health data. The databases covered include the Integrated Public Use Microdata Series (IPUMS-USA, IPUMS-International,  and IPUMS-CPS), the Integrated Health Interview Series (IHIS), the National Historical Geographic Information System (NHGIS) and the North Atlantic Population Project (NAPP).
  • Geographic Information Systems: Analyzing Data and Creating Maps. This 7-hour workshop will introduce participants to using a geographic information system (GIS) to analyze data and create maps.  The Spring 2012 workshops will be held on January 27, February 24, March 30, and April 27.
